A playful, wonder-filled introduction to foraging for curious minds of all ages. This hands-on experience invites children and adults alike to explore the land together, building confidence in noticing, identifying, and connecting with wild plants in a safe and accessible way.

Did you know that some plants have been here for so long that they would have been eaten by dinosaurs? And that there is a type of mushroom that allows you to leave a secret message?! Together, we’ll explore how to observe key edible and useful plants and engage creatively with the landscape through simple sensory activities, helping deepen observation and memory.

Through drawing, mark-making, and playful observation, families will create their own nature field notes. You’ll make rubbings, gather visual impressions, and begin to build a shared language of noticing and connection.
